The durability of CPVC sheets is one of their most defining features. Unlike traditional PVC, CPVC is chlorinated via a free radical chlorination reaction that enhances its temperature and chemical resistance. This makes CPVC sheets perfect for use in industrial settings where exposure to corrosive chemicals and high temperatures is common. For instance, in the chemical processing industry, CPVC sheets are frequently used to line tanks and vessels due to their resistance to acids, alkalis, and a wide range of chemicals. In addition to their chemical resilience, CPVC sheets boast impressive thermal properties. They can endure temperatures up to 200°F (93°C), which significantly exceeds the capabilities of standard PVC. This high heat resistance allows them to be utilized in applications where other plastics would fail, such as in the production of ductwork or as components in industrial heating systems. Moreover, CPVC sheets maintain their integrity and mechanical strength even under continuous service conditions, ensuring long-term reliability and safety.

Beyond industrial use, CPVC sheets offer versatility for construction projects. Their lightweight nature simplifies handling and installation, without compromising on strength or stability. These sheets can be easily cut, shaped, and joined, offering flexibility for various architectural applications. Architects and builders often utilize CPVC in the creation of panels, partitions, and cladding, leveraging their smooth surface finish which can be tailored to different aesthetic needs while providing excellent insulation properties.cpvc sheet
CPVC sheets also contribute significantly to water treatment and plumbing. Their ability to resist biofilm formation and microbial growth makes them a superior choice for water distribution systems, ensuring water remains uncontaminated and safe for consumption. Their low thermal conductivity reduces heat loss from hot water, contributing to energy efficiency—a critical consideration in eco-friendly building designs.
